About Ebony Johnson's service

Hi there, My name is Ebony Johnson and I am a Licensed Professional Counselor in Pennsylvania. If you found your way to my page I’m assuming that you’re probably not having the best day. Let me assure you that whatever you are going through, there is a way out. I have experience with Depression, Anxiety, OCD, Relationship issues, self esteem and many others in the adult and college student population. I believe that all of us at our core want to feel accepted, loved, appreciated and want our lives to make a difference. My approach to therapy is always warm, accepting, and validating but at the same time encouraging growth from areas that seem to keep you stuck. I help my clients recognize the power they have to make small changes which can lead to a more satisfying life. I would love to help you construct your life in a way that feels much more valuable and filled with new purpose.
